From 670920e0707d51e713fba4149f0d2433aadde0e0 Mon Sep 17 00:00:00 2001 From: jensp Date: Sat, 1 Mar 2014 14:10:58 +0000 Subject: [PATCH] Added a year parameter of the export function. Using /ccm/scipublications/export?format=$format&year=$year it is now possible to export all publications for a specific year. git-svn-id: https://svn.libreccm.org/ccm/trunk@2548 8810af33-2d31-482b-a856-94f89814c4df --- .../cms/scipublications/SciPublicationsServlet.java |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/ccm-sci-publications/src/com/arsdigita/cms/scipublications/SciPublicationsServlet.java b/ccm-sci-publications/src/com/arsdigita/cms/scipublications/SciPublicationsServlet.java index 9820111c4..2e18addc9 100644 --- a/ccm-sci-publications/src/com/arsdigita/cms/scipublications/SciPublicationsServlet.java +++ b/ccm-sci-publications/src/com/arsdigita/cms/scipublications/SciPublicationsServlet.java @@ -493,6 +493,11 @@ public class SciPublicationsServlet extends BaseApplicationServlet { getNegotiatedLocale().getLanguage()); } + if (parameters.containsKey("year")) { + publications.addEqualsFilter("yearOfPublication", + parameters.get("year")[0]); + } + publications.addOrder("yearOfPublication desc"); publications.addOrder("authorsStr"); publications.addOrder("title");